Output 37208622dc88cc67ad2c65621b86ea48bb253b04fbc20636d8150f4d67563206:1

value
528050
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1971526e15920a915b2810b89b38ee86cad220aa OP_EQUALVERIFY OP_CHECKSIG
address
13KXeYf8hfohWAD3Bm3Ry8NpA3zefiBtxN
transaction
37208622dc88cc67ad2c65621b86ea48bb253b04fbc20636d8150f4d67563206
spent
true